Today we have a guest blogger from Game Entertainment Technology. He is Eugene Choy who is a DPA student for AY11/12. He shares with us about his life during his time as a DPA student.


7 Feb was the 1st day for my DPA Polytechnic Preparatory Programme. I walked into Temasek Polytechnic feeling both excited and nervous at the same time. I was worried whether the people there will be easy going or difficult to get along with.

We gathered outside one of the Lecture Theatres collected our matriculation card and proceeded into the Lecture hall. There were DPA seniors over there who were trying to help us break the ice with other DPA students. Most of us were very shy initially and did not really respond.

On the 2nd day, We were divided into several groups and did many ice-breaking and bonding games. These activities help us opened up to some of the DPA students in 1 day. We were soon exchanging our contacts just after the 2nd day of the programme. This was the first time that I in such a short time manage to make so many friends and even get their contacts. This was one of my most memorable experience I had in DPA Polytechnic Preparatory Programme.

After a period of 2 Weeks, We started off with some Cross-Disciplinary Subjects ( CDS) . I took Japanese & Culture and Transnational Studies as my CDS-es. We were required to interact with other classmates in our class during Japanese classes and Transnational Studies so we also made many new friends.

Just after our CDS started, We had our residential stay. We were assigned to stay in Temasek Green( The hostel just beside Engine sch). Each apartment have roughly about 5 people staying. Transnational Residential Stay was the most memorable experience I had in my Preparatory Programme. Although we had a curfew where we are required to stay in our own apartment after 11pm, we still went to each other’s apartment. There will be around 20 people in one of the groups apartment and we will start playing games and bond with each other. The Residential Stay was very fun but the fun did not last long. We had to move out just after 2 weeks. Although, the residential Stay was very short , we had fostered a very strong relationship with many other DPA students.

The last programme we had for our Preparatory Programme was the School Discovery Programme. For students from IIT sch , we completed another CDS which is Effective Internet research. This CDS helped to teach us on how to obtain resources for research effectively. This CDS also taught us how to make us of the databases that are available in TP. Therefore , this programme was very useful.

Overall , DPA was a very memorable experience for me. I was able to create strong bonds with many people from different schools and take Cross disciplinary subject which helps in my graduation. I would advise anyone who have a passion in any course to apply for DPA.

Hi readers! I am Ivan Goh from Diploma in Interactive Media Informatics (IMI). Im a freshie this year and will be joining my classmates for Orientation tomorrow!

I got to share a little about myself on IMI's blog because I am a DPA (Direct Polytechnic Admission) student for 2011. IMI is my choice because I simply adore animation and I believe that this course will be interesting, and interest is a start to success!

As a DPA student, I started classes earlier than others. The three modules I took in the past two months are Japanese, Transnational studies and EIR (effective internet research). These modules are all cross disciplinary subjects which help to reduce my workload during sch time.

I enjoyed DPA as it let me have a chance to know TP earlier than my fellow peers. It also gave me a chance to meet others from different courses and adopt to poly life faster.

Some of the things I will do when I'm freewould be to play computer games. I love watching Youtube , most of the things I watch are anime (Japanese cartoon) as I feel that the storylines are more interesting.

My favorite hangouts are mostly the LAN shops. My favourite internet sites include Wikipedia and GameFAQs for information.

I really look forward to my start of 3yrs in TP as an IMI student! Enjoy school life!

Hey it’s RAINE! Here to blog something since it has been a while since I blogged.  
As my freshman year has ended. (yays to holidays that I’m having now) I decided to do a reflection entry on one of the modules I took in semester 1.2.
This module is called multimedia project 1 (mmp1). It’s one of the modules I looked forward to every time in my previous semester since the others modules are rather dry for my preference. This module is all about being creative. When I first took this module I had a hard time to come up with new ideas as I was rather afraid that my ideas may be silly. But as the time passes I learnt how to think of more ideas and also modify them so that it will become a good idea.

Some of my work:

(self promotion poster)


(my concept, for a new stamp design, prototype)

Why do I love this module compared to the others? Well, this module makes me use my creativity to think of new ideas, I get to use my favorite software and also have a field trip to museums and come up with new ideas for my project work. I had some difficulties coming up with my report and generating new ideas. But it was a fun experience and not forgetting that my hard work for this module paid off with an awesome grade!
I hope the new freshman will enjoy this module like I did when they take it in 1.2 (:
